Output 39aef0528068c4fb36dbe9c147b49eaf1dc35835717d4ca91ab650a619ad0032:0

value
8550626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a31857b9879ae1dac3b9ad4efe1e6234cb0d632 OP_EQUAL
address
3HCv7xpqHkSRk4235zGW1rvxVMhLUbiDa5
transaction
39aef0528068c4fb36dbe9c147b49eaf1dc35835717d4ca91ab650a619ad0032
spent
true